Electronic Temperature Instruments Limited (ETI) is a worldwide manufacturer and distributor of thermometers and portable test and measurement instrumentation. ETI supplies catering, industrial, HVAC, wireless, legionnaires, refrigeration thermometers and environmental monitoring instruments to various industries. These include food production, chemical, pharmaceutical and construction services.

History

The company was founded in 1983 in Worthing, West Sussex, England.[citation needed] The company has been privately owned since inception.[1]

ETI has been granted The Queen's Award for Industry for International Trade three times: in 2012,[2] 2014,[3] and 2017,[4] and the Queen’s Award for Enterprise for Innovation in 2018.[citation needed]

Accreditation

As of 2023, the company is accredited for a number of equipment calibration activities.[5]
